- Overall anterior fascial closure rate post-transversus abdominis release was 93.9%.
 - Hernia widths of 15-20 cm and >20 cm significantly lower closure odds (0.39 and 0.05 respectively).
 - History of open abdomen and higher ASA classification also correlate with non-closure (0.33 and 0.39 respectively).
 
Proper patient selection and recognition of risk factors can enhance surgical outcomes and reduce infection rates post-repair.
- Fascial non-closure directly increases wound morbidity and is linked to higher rates of one-year surgical site infections.
